Each and every weekend, you’ll find car enthusiasts carefully washing their cars, but this is just surface maintenance. However, do they have the same enthusiasm for looking after their car’s engine? Your car’s engine won’t work properly unless you take some crucial steps. Your car’s health depends upon these fundamentals, one of which is changing the oil after every 3000 to 5000 miles. Through the use of synthetic oils, which have a lower malfunction rate, you can increase your engine’s efficiency.
Even the smallest of soil particles may affect the functioning of your engine. You can prevent this by regularly changing your oil filter. You never do your engine any favors when you change the oil but never replace the dirty oil filter. To enjoy a smoothly operating vehicle, make sure that you change the oil regularly, and try to change the filter at the same time. Through lifting the hood of your vehicle and looking at the dipstick, you can check your car’s oil level whenever it’s convenient for you. Do not fill your oil higher than than F mark or permit it to dip below the E mark as you can cause significant damage to your car in either case.
Whenever your engine is performing improperly, the dipstick will probably have dark-colored stains, which are most often carbon deposits. However, if your engine is in good working order and does not need an oil change, the oil will have a clear golden color. Be sure to check underneath your engine frequently to make certain no oil is leaking. You also need to check the engine coolant, because if there is any presence of oil in the coolant, then there is a rising problem with the radiator. This can create a major problem for your engine.
You will need to examine the parts of your engine, but you need to listen to your car while driving. The sounds that your automobile creates are one of the only ways your car can communicate with you so be sure to pay attention.

One thing that causes many drivers concern is hearing a new noise from the car. During spring, this is especially noticeable when you roll down the window for the first time.
Everyday you drive your car. This means you know how it should handle. If, more than once, you notice that something is amiss, then you better get it checked out. You may save yourself a lot of inconvenience and money in the long run. It’s important for you and your mechanic to be team when it comes to your car maintenance. You however need to be the eyes and ears of the team.
You need to pay attention every so often when you pull your car out of a parking space. Did you notice if there’s any fresh fluid? It’s hard to tell sometimes due to the stains left from other cars. How about your driveway? Do you see any new stains? If you did, what’s the fluid’s color? Oil will be quite obvious, appearing black or dark brown. With its yellow green color, antifreeze would be easy to recognize. Also unmistakable is the odor of antifreeze. Fluid that’s reddish in color is either power steering or transmission fluid.
You also need to notice how your car is handling. Find out if it’s pulling to one side when you stop. It may be time for a front end alignment. Keep a check on your tire pressure. Lower gas mileage can be the cause of under inflated tires. On a regular basis, get your tires rotated in order to prevent wear.
Are you breaks squealing? You shouldn’t let this problem go on and get to the mechanic as soon as possible. If you continue driving, you may have to replace worn rotors and break pads. Rotors are quite expensive.
Did you notice if your car is acting sluggish? Maybe it’s not accelerating like it used to. It may be time for a tune up. Maybe you’re also noticing hesitation. May be the gas filter.
Make sure you have your oil changed every 3,000 miles. Whether your car is new or old, this rule is very important. Among the most essential stages in the detailing system is getting the rims meticulously detailed. A set of clean wheels and tires can take the aesthetics of the car to a completely new quality. Soiled rims and tires on the other hand is going to take from the appearance of the nice car.
All high level or qualified car detail shop should explain how using acid wheel cleaner is certainly a horrible approach. These kinds of products won’t just induce long-term damage to the coating on your wheels and the rubber of the tire but will potentially cause really serious immediate deterioration.
Take advantage of citrus rim cleaner. Simple enough. Acid is definitely harmful and hard while citrus is without a doubt effective and safe for use. Just do some online research. You will discover some very good solutions out there. Without handing out some of our industry secrets, our own rim cleaning solution costs about $50 a gallon. Acid solution cleanser is around $40 for every 5 gallons.
